How they compare

Fiji currently reports 1.13 billion BoP, current US$ against 1.01 billion BoP, current US$ in Faroe Islands, a difference of 123.33 million BoP, current US$.

That makes Fiji's figure about 1.1 times Faroe Islands's.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 14 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Faroe Islands ahead.

Globally, Faroe Islands ranks 153rd and Fiji ranks 150th of 199 countries.

Exports of goods occur when there are changes in the economic ownership of goods from residents of the compiling economy to non-residents, irrespective of physical movement of goods across national borders.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
